Argonne & QuEra's Repeater Test: What It Means for Quantum Jobs
Researchers at the U.S. Department of Energy’s Argonne National Laboratory, in collaboration with QuEra Computing, have announced a significant advance in quantum networking. In a paper published today, the team details the successful operation of a quantum repeater prototype that maintained entanglement between two nodes separated by a 52-kilometer optical fiber link. Quantum repeaters are essential for overcoming the decoherence and signal loss that plague quantum states when transmitted over long distances, acting as a series of intermediate stations that refresh the quantum connection without destroying it. This achievement represents a critical step toward building large-scale, distributed quantum computing systems and a secure quantum internet. While still an experimental result, the demonstration on existing fiber infrastructure highlights a tangible pathway from laboratory research to real-world quantum communication networks.
What This Means for Quantum Careers
This breakthrough directly translates into new and evolving career opportunities at the intersection of quantum physics and network engineering. As the industry pushes toward distributed quantum systems, we anticipate a rise in demand for roles like 'Quantum Network Engineer' and 'Quantum Protocol Developer.' Job seekers with a hybrid skill set—combining knowledge of quantum optics, photonics, and entanglement with classical networking principles, fiber optics, and control systems—will be exceptionally well-positioned. Companies like QuEra, along with national labs and emerging startups in the quantum networking space, will be looking for research scientists and engineers to refine these repeater technologies. Furthermore, software roles will emerge for developing the communication protocols and operating systems necessary to manage these nascent networks, signaling the maturation of a new, highly specialized career track.
This milestone signals a surge in demand for specialists who can bridge the gap between quantum physics and classical network engineering.
